在当今快速发展的互联网时代,网页设计不仅仅是信息展示的工具,更是用户交互体验的核心。同步功能作为网页设计中的一项重要属性,极大地提升了用户体验和数据处理的效率。本文将深入探讨同步功能在网页设计中的作用和特点。
一、同步功能的基本概念
同步功能通常指的是在不同时间或空间内,确保数据、信息或操作的一致性。在网页设计中,这种功能尤为重要,因为它涉及到不同设备之间的数据交流、实时更新和用户交互。
1. 实时更新的数据同步
实时数据同步是网页设计中最常见的同步功能之一。当用户在一个设备上进行操作时,其他设备也能即时看到相应的更新。例如,在社交媒体网站上,用户发布的内容能够立即显示在关注者的动态中,这样的功能刺激了用户的参与感和互动体验。
2. 跨平台操作的无缝连接
人们常常通过多种设备(如手机、平板、电脑)访问网页。同步功能能够确保在不同平台上,用户的操作和数据保持一致。背景信息的统一管理,使得用户可以随时随地进行操作,无需担心数据丢失或不一致的情况。
二、同步功能的具体作用
1. 提升用户体验
在网页设计中,用户体验至关重要。通过实现实时的与用户行为的响应,用户在页面上的操作变得更加流畅。例如,当用户在购物网站上加入购物车时,利用同步功能可以确保购物车信息在用户的所有设备上都能实时更新,这种无缝体验让用户感到便利。
2. 加强信息安全
同步功能在信息安全上也发挥着重要的作用。数据的实时备份和同步可以减少数据丢失的风险,确保用户提交的信息能够安全存储。此外,访问权限的同步也保障了敏感信息的安全性,只有授权用户才能查看特定数据。
3. 实现高效的团队协作
在团队项目中,同步功能使得成员之间的信息共享更为便捷。无论是文档编辑、项目管理还是设计想法的交流,通过实时同步,各个团队成员都可以在同一个平台上进行合作,提升整体工作效率。
三、同步功能的特点
1. 高即时性
同步功能的一个显著特点就是其高即时性。在网页设计中,用户几乎可以在任何时刻看到信息的变动。这种即时反馈机制不仅提高了用户的参与度,也增强了用户对平台的信任感。
2. 多设备兼容性
现代网页设计需要考虑到多样化的设备使用情况。同步功能应具备良好的多设备兼容性,确保在不同终端上无缝操作。这意味着开发者必须考虑诸如浏览器适配、响应式设计等多个维度,以保证同步的顺利进行。
3. 易用性和可访问性
除了高效性,易用性和可访问性也是同步功能不可或缺的特点。用户界面设计要简单明了,让用户可以轻松上手。此外,设计时还需要考虑到不同用户的需求,使得每一个人都能便捷地使用同步功能。
四、实现同步功能的技术手段
1. WebSocket技术
WebSocket是一种高效的双向通信协议,能够实时传递数据。在网页设计中,通过WebSocket实现的数据同步,可以保证用户在操作时即刻看到更新信息。这种技术适合于需要高频率更新的应用场景,例如在线聊天或游戏。
2. AJAX异步请求
采用AJAX技术,网页在不重新加载整个页面的情况下,能够与服务器进行数据交换,实时刷新内容。这种异步请求的特性使得用户在进行某些操作时不会感觉到页面延迟,从而提升了用户体验。
3. 数据库的实时同步
在后端,借助NoSQL数据库与实时数据处理框架,开发者可以将用户的操作和变动实时存储和同步。这个过程确保了无论用户在何时进行操作,数据始终保持最新状态。
五、总结
同步功能在网页设计中发挥着不可或缺的作用,涵盖了从提升用户体验到保障信息安全的方方面面。随着技术的不断进步,开发者需要持续关注同步机制及其实现方式,使之更好地服务于用户和产品。在设计中把握好这些特点和作用,能够帮助我们创造出更具吸引力和实用性的网页产品。